Michael Breitbach is an American politician who served as a member of the Iowa Senate for the 28th district from 2013 to 2021. Breitbach was born in Manchester, Iowa and he resides in Strawberry Point, Iowa.[1]

Breitbach served on the following committees in the Iowa Senate: Commerce, Natural Resources and Environment, and Transportation.[1] He also serves on the Commission on Tobacco Use Prevention and Control, and on the following interim study committees: Cannabidiol Implementation Study Committee, and Emergency Medical Services Study Committee.[1]

Iowa Senate 28th District election, 2012 [2]
Party Candidate Votes %
Republican Michael Breitbach 14,868 50.0%
Democratic John Beard 14,851 49.9%
Nonpartisan Write-in 21 0.1%
Republican hold
